One of my co-workers recently asked me
to make a sympathy card for someone in her family.
And while I was happy to do it, 
sympathy cards can be tricky to make.
I've found that simple design and classic
fonts and images seem to work best.




On this card, I used an emboss-resist technique
with two different hero arts stamps, a vintage book page,
a Fiskars sentiment stamp, some Distress Inks, and twine.
